你查询的IP:[122.51.220.240]  地理位置:中国–上海–上海

最新查询221.176.19.31 121.58.105.201 58.14.150.96 123.180.233.71 221.208.252.236 220.112.57.177 117.32.192.108 220.242.50.58 202.38.160.84 122.51.220.240 202.125.176.193 120.137.79.183 118.64.252.241 119.60.28.226 119.176.30.47 118.89.54.88 202.127.216.236 202.158.160.240 116.196.139.21 121.101.208.227 210.32.195.60 122.136.113.66 203.89.137.123 121.68.154.10 116.76.51.58 119.148.160.124 203.207.64.57 116.194.234.12 120.54.213.105 211.96.98.1 202.127.212.135